GoogleMap.OnCameraMoveStartedListener

公共静态接口 GoogleMap.OnCameraMoveStartedListener

镜头运动开始时的回调接口。

常量摘要

int REASON_API_ANIMATION 为响应用户操作而启动的非手势动画。
int REASON_DEVELOPER_ANIMATION 开发者启动的动画。
int REASON_GESTURE 为响应用户在地图上所做的手势而发起的镜头移动操作。

公共方法摘要

abstract void
onCameraMoveStarted(整数原因)
当相机在闲置后开始移动时或相机移动原因发生变化时调用。

常量

public static final int REASON_API_ANIMATION

为响应用户操作而启动的非手势动画。例如:缩放按钮、“我的位置”按钮或标记点击。

常量值: 2

public static final int REASON_DEVELOPER_ANIMATION

开发者启动的动画。

常量值: 3

public static final int REASON_GESTURE

为响应用户在地图上所做的手势而发起的镜头移动操作。例如:平移、倾斜、双指张合进行缩放或旋转。

常量值: 1

公共方法

public abstract void onCameraMoveStarted (int reason)

当相机在闲置后开始移动时或相机移动原因发生变化时调用。请勿在此方法中更新镜头或为镜头添加动画效果。

此方法在 Android 界面线程上调用。

参数
原因 镜头更改的原因。可能的值包括: